What Is a Work Hours Calculator?

A work hours calculator is an online tool designed to simplify the process of calculating total work hours and overtime pay. This calculator takes inputs such as regular hours, overtime hours, and hourly rates to provide precise earnings.

Essential Tips for Using a Work Hours Calculator

To maximize the benefits of a work hours calculator, consider these helpful tips. They can ensure accurate calculations and fair compensation, making the process smoother for both employees and employers.

  • Input Accurate Hours: Always enter exact regular and overtime hours worked to ensure correct payroll calculations. Small mistakes can lead to significant discrepancies in earnings.
  • Know Your Hourly Rate: Make sure to enter your correct hourly wage. If you have different rates for regular and overtime hours, input each accurately for precise calculations.
  • Review Overtime Rules: Familiarize yourself with your company’s overtime policies. Understanding when overtime applies can help ensure you’re compensated fairly.
  • Use for Budgeting: Leverage the calculator not just for payroll but also for budgeting your finances. Knowing your earnings can aid in expense planning.
  • Check Local Laws: Stay updated with local labor laws regarding overtime pay. This knowledge can protect your rights and help ensure compliance.
  • Revisit Regularly: Regularly review your calculations, especially if your hours fluctuate. Staying consistent will help keep your finances in check.

FAQs About Work Hours Calculator With Overtime Pay

What is a work hours calculator with overtime pay?

A work hours calculator helps determine total work hours, including overtime, ensuring accurate pay for employees based on their hours worked.

How do I use a work hours calculator?

To use the calculator, input your regular hours, overtime hours, and pay rates to find your total earnings for the pay period.

Why is calculating overtime important?

Calculating overtime is crucial for compliance with labor laws and ensuring that employees receive fair compensation for extra hours worked.

Can I calculate overtime manually?

Yes, you can calculate overtime manually by multiplying overtime hours by the overtime rate, but using a calculator simplifies the process significantly.
